Iribancha, also called Kyobancha, is known for its unique smoky aroma and its refreshing flavour. It is produced by roasting green tea leaves flat until they start to smoke. People in Kyoto have long enjoyed Iribancha with meals and throughout the day to stay hydrated. Since it has less caffeine than other green teas, people also drink it in the evening to relax.

How to Make Perfect Iribancha:

  1. Add a tea bag to a 400ml of freshly boiled water.

  2. Steep for 5 minutes, and then remove the teabag.

  3. Sit back and enjoy your tea!
